Bodybuilding is both a recreational and competitive activity that involves intensive muscle hypertrophy. An individual who engages in this activity is referred to as a bodybuilder. It is a sport that requires discipline, dedication, and a strict regimen of weightlifting, diet, and rest. Key Components of Bodybuilding: 1. **Training:** - **Resistance Training:** This is the cornerstone of bodybuilding. It involves lifting weights to induce muscle hypertrophy. Common exercises include bench presses, deadlifts, squats, and bicep curls. - **Split Routines:** Bodybuilders often follow split routines, targeting different muscle groups on different days. For example, one day might be dedicated to chest and triceps, while another day focuses on back and biceps. - **Progressive Overload:** Gradually increasing the weight, frequency, or number of repetitions in your training routine to continuously challenge your muscles. 2. **Nutrition:** - **Macronutrients:** A balanced intake of proteins, carbohydrates, and fats is crucial. Protein is particularly important for muscle repair and growth. - **Micronutrients:** Vitamins and minerals are essential for overall health and optimal muscle function. - **Supplements:** Many bodybuilders use supplements like protein powders, creatine, branched-chain amino acids (BCAAs), and pre-workout formulas to enhance performance and recovery. 3. **Rest and Recovery:** - **Sleep:** Adequate sleep is vital for muscle recovery and growth.
